HP 3PAR Physical Disk
PATROL Class: SEN_HP3P_PHYSICALDISK - Monitor Type: MONITOR - Monitor Category: System
No CDM Class defined.
 
Monitors a specific physical disk.
Attributes (Parameters)
| Name | PATROL Name | Units | Default Thresholds | Description | 
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Capacity | Capacity | GB | None |   Capacity of the physical disk. Type: Statistics  |  
    
| Chunklet Count | ChunkletCount | chunklets | None |   Total number of chunklets. Type: Spikes expected  |  
    
| Chunklet Size | ChunkletSize | MB | None |   Chunklet size of the physical disk. Type: Spikes expected  |  
    
| Consumed Capacity | ConsumedCapacity | GB | None |   Number of bytes actually consumed in the physical disk. Type: Statistics  |  
    
| Consumed Capacity Percentage | ConsumedCapacityPercentage | % | None |   Percentage of the capacity that is actually consumed in the physical disk. Type: Statistics  |  
    
| Disk Time Utilization | DiskTimeUtilization | % | None |   Percentage of disk time utilization. Type: Statistics -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Errors Per Day | ErrorsPerDay | errors |    WARN  ALARM  |  
       Number of correctable and uncorrectable read and write errors per day. Type: Statistics -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Operation Rate | OperationRate | operations/s | None |   Total number of operations per second. Type: Statistics -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Present | Present | 0 = No 1 = Yes  |  
        ALARM  |  
       Indicates whether the device is still present or not since the last discovery. This parameter is updated at each collect. Type: Availability -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Queue Length | QueueLength | operations | None |   Number of operations on the disk that are either in service or waiting for service. Type: Statistics -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Read Byte Rate | ReadByteRate | MB/s | None |   Bytes read per second from the physical disk since the last collect. Type: Statistics -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Read Operation Rate | ReadOperationRate | operations/s | None |   Number of read operations per second. Type: Statistics -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Read Response Time | ReadResponseTime | ms |    WARN  |  
       Average response time for read operations. Type: Response Time -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Response Time | ResponseTime | ms |    WARN  |  
       Average response time for all operations. Type: Response Time -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Status | Status | 0 = OK 1 = Degraded 2 = Failed  |  
        WARN  ALARM  |  
       Status of the physical disk. Type: Availability - Spikes expected - Default graph  |  
    
| Status Information | StatusInformation | None | None |   Detailed information about the physical disk status. Type: Text  |  
    
| Transfer Byte Rate | TransferByteRate | MB/s | None |   Total bytes read and written per second to the physical disk. Type: Statistics - Spikes expected - Default graph  |  
    
| Write Byte Rate | WriteByteRate | MB/s | None |   Bytes written per second to the physical disk since the last collect. Type: Statistics -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Write Operation Rate | WriteOperationRate | operations/s | None |   Number of write operations per second. Type: Statistics - Spikes expected  |  
    
| Write Response Time | WriteResponseTime | ms |    WARN  |  
       Average response time for write operations. Type: Response Time - Spikes expected  |  
    
Infoboxes (PATROL Console Only)
| Name | Description | 
|---|---|
| PATROL ID | The PATROL internal identifier. | 
| Vendor | Hardware vendor identifier. | 
| Model | Model of the physical disk. | 
| Serial Number | Serial number of the physical disk. | 
| Disk Type | Type of the physical disk (FC | NL | SSD). | 
| Disk Interconnect Type | Type of interconnection with the physical disk. | 
| RPM | Revolutions Per Minute. | 
| WWN | World Wide Name of the physical disk. | 
| Size | Size of the physical disk. |
